GNDU registration begins for 5-year, 3-year llb courses; apply by June 26
Vikas Kumar Pandit | May 14, 2024 | 12:56 PM IST | 1 min read
Punjab Law Admission 2024: The university will conduct admissions based on the merit obtained in the qualifying examination.
NEW DELHI: Guru Nanak Dev University (GNDU) Amritsar has opened the registration window for admission to its 5-year, 3-year Bachelor of Laws (LLB) courses. Eligible candidates will be able to register for Panjab law admission by visiting the university's official website, gnduadmissions.org.
The last date to fill out the application form for the GNDU 3-year, 5-year LLB course is June 26, 2024. Students applying for the GNDU admission 2024 will have to pay a registration fee of Rs 1,500 for each programme. However, the application fee for the scheduled caste (SC) category of Punjab domicile is Rs 750.
The university will conduct admissions based on the merit obtained in the qualifying examination. Candidates should score a minimum percentage of marks, not below 45% of the total marks for general category applicants and 40% of the total marks for scheduled caste (SC), scheduled tribe (ST) applicants, in the qualifying examination. This applies to examinations such as the Class 12 examination for integrated five-year courses or degree courses in any discipline for the three-year LLB course.
Students can courses-wise eligibility criteria from the GNDU 2024 prospectus, which can be downloaded through the official website. The university has reserved 85% of seats for candidates from the state of Punjab, while 15% of seats are reserved for other state candidates.

GNDU Application Form: How to apply
Candidates can follow the steps given below to fill out the Punjab law admission 2024 application form.
-
Visit the GNDu’s official website, gnduadmissions.org
-
On the homepage, click on the “Punjab Law Admissions (Session 2024-25)” link.
-
Now, click on the “Online Registration” tab.
-
Complete the registration process by entering details including email ID, mobile number, name, etc.
-
Upload the required documents, make payment and submit the form.
-
Download the form and take a printout for future reference.
